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 26 Next »

Workbench Release Notes

Beta Release 4.5.43.1

Scheduled Release - 28 November 2022

New Feature

Jobs

  • Limiting access to tabs on Job Enquiry:
    A new setting ‘Job Enquiry Tabs’ has been added to define and limit access to the different tabs when required. If the setting is not configured, then users can see all tabs.

Timesheets

  • TOIL balance on Timesheets:


    In those cases where Time Off In Lieu (TOIL) is tracked using a nominated Job, the TOIL balance for each employee can now be displayed on timesheets.
    This TOIL Job must be defined in each Financial Company. A new field has been added for this purpose. If this field is populated, and the employee belongs to this Financial Company, the TOIL balance will display on a Timesheet screen (Timesheet Administration, Daily Timesheet, Weekly Timesheet).

    Recording TOIL accrued – Manual Process:
    When recording their timesheet, the employee also manually records their accrued TOIL to their TOIL Job on the timesheet as a negative quantity

    • Assuming a Time-For-Time method, if I work 10 hrs (2 hours beyond my standard schedule), I record 10 hours against the project job and also -2 hrs (negative) against the TOIL job. Toil Hours is negative on the Toil Job. The net effect being the Employee's Total Hours paid for the day should be 8 (10-2) with the other 2 owed to her at some point in the future.

    • With a penalty method like Time and a half for the first two hours if also being applied to TOIL, my 2 hours beyond my standard schedule would be recorded as 10 hours against the project job and also -3 hours (negative) against the TOIL job.

Recording TOIL taken:
When the employee takes time off using the accrued TOIL they record time taken against the TOIL Job rather than against the generic Admin job.

If I take 2 hrs off against my TOIL I record it as 2 hrs (positive) against the TOIL Job.

This process builds up a negative balance in the TOIL Job which is Hours in excess of standard hours; this is time owed to the employee. When the Employee takes this time off, the recording of that time is a positive entry to the TOIL job which then reduces the balance owed.

Note: The is no restriction that the employee’s TOIL must remain >= 0 i.e. they may take time off against TOIL and work the hour back in the future.

Upvise

  • New Equipment & Light Vehicle Service Forms
    Two new standard Equipment Servicing forms have been introduced where the “Kms/Hrs” recorded on the service form will update the equipment’s utilization.

    • Light Vehicle Service Record

    • Equipment Service Record

Feature Revisions

Jobs

  • Job Enquiry - Revenue tab changes:

    Several changes have been done to the Revenue tab:

    • Added a Claim Date separate from the Invoice date.

    • New year/Period column.

    • Revenue entered using Revenue journals is now displayed. Tip: if the Finco on the Job that is being enquired has a Revenue Journal Job setting, then it will display any revenue journals where the enquiry job is used on the lines.

    • GST Column has been removed

    • Foreign Currency values are now displayed for Prepayments and Revenue.

  • Budget reports:
    Budget reports now support custom Budget Type Descriptions and Report Titles.

  • Procurement List purchasing:
    When purchasing from a Procurement List, if the Job had no Job Work Centres, the system was not allowing the use of any Work Centres. This has been rectified, and if no JWCs are defined, then any Work Centre Codes are valid when creating Purchase Orders from a Procurement List.

Dockets & Daysheets

Daysheets:

  • Closed Job Work Centres can no longer be selected on Daysheets.

Purchasing

  • Purchase Order - address validation:
    A delivery address on a PO can be either selected from the Job’s addresses or typed in. We have improved the validation of a delivery address by checking whether one or the other exists. This will avoid invalid missing address error messages.

  • PO Outstanding values for partially receipted Stock purchases:
    When purchasing stock items, then partially receipting them in Inwards Goods and processing a voucher for these partially receipted lines, outstanding values in a PO were going negative. This has been rectified.

  • Purchase Order line details pop-up screen enhancements:
    In some very specific cases, AP vouchers not related to a particular PO line were displayed as if they were linked to it. This has been rectified.

Stock

  • Inwards goods when using Stock multiplier on a catalogue item:
    A few fixes had to be done when receipting stock items that have a Stock Multiplier set (stock item in one unit but purchasing from a supplier in a different unit of measure).
    Stock Transactions screen:

    • Receipt type: calculating Rate column by dividing by the Stock Multiplier(if set)

    • Order type: System now calculates the Rate column by dividing by the Stock Multiplier(if set), and the Quantity column by multiplying by the Stock Multiplier (if set).

    Inwards Goods Job Transactions:

    • Variance and clearing transactions now have their cost divided by the Stock Multiplier (if set).

  • Negative Stock issues on Stock issues import:
    Control parameter 'Allow Negative Qty Stock' is now taken into consideration when importing stock issues into a Batch.

  • Month End - Stock Close validation:
    The validation that checks whether the Stock Close process has been done or not, has been removed when not using 'Average' stock method.

Subcontracts

  • Future Claimed new status on Subcontract Claim lines:
    A new status has been added to Work Order lines in a Subcontract Claim to indicate this line has been already claimed in a future Claim. The line is not editable/claimable on this Claim.

Plant

  • Plant Assignment Bulk Issue batch:
    Date range filter to find Plant issues to be generated on the Plant Assignment Bulk screen has been improved so when start date/end date in the filters intersect the plant assignment dates, then they are displayed and can be selected.

  • Enquiry screen:
    Plant items (Plant jobs) now use the same Enquiry screen used for Jobs, plus the Recovery tab which is specific for Plant Items. This brings a more standardised approach for users when analysing data on either a Plant Job or a Project Job.
    Tip: Use the setting 'Plant Enquiry Tabs' to define and limit what tabs each user can see.

  • Service Logs can now be created against a Plant Item:
    This would typically be a repair for a Plant Item. Work done on your own mechanic workshop.
    Logs can be viewed from Plant Item Enquiry, on the Logs tab.
    Upvise Jobs against a Plant Item will flow to Workbench Logs as a Plant Item Log.

Timesheets

  • Timesheet imports and employees' Standard Work Hours:
    When importing timesheets, rather than entering them from the UI, Standard Week hours for that timesheet for an employee are not assigned correctly. This has been rectified. Note: Standard hours for each employee are configured on the Extended Productivity tab. These are then used in a Timesheet to compare worked hours vs the hours that should have been worked.

Service Desk

  • Link to Log from the Service Log AR invoice:
    On an AR Invoice linked to a Log, the Logno under the 'Details' section, is now a hyperlink to navigate back to the Log. It displays the LogNo and the Log Order Number: {Log No} : {Order No}

Month End

  • Exporting a batch when no financial system has been set:
    When a user tries to export a batch and no financial system has been set (hence setting ‘'Financial System’' is empty), a new message will display warning the user that no financial system has been set for the financial company of the batch.

  • Utilities - WIP Adjustments:
    When making changes to the Adjusted % Complete on Cost value in the Adjustments screen, all values now refresh after saving. No need to close and re-open the screen to see the values updated (wink)

Integrations

Upvise

  • “Equipment Record” from Equipment Matrix:
    We made an enhancement to the “Equipment Record” to allow these forms to be created from the Equipment Matrix.

    This enhancement addresses the scenario where the form was created from the Equipment Matrix or forms application, and the due date did not show in the matrix view as the link to the equipment was not populated. 

    Existing clients using the equipment Matrix should engage support to receive this enhancement.

  • SMS Sender:
    A new Control Parameter was introduced in Upvise to allow the name change of the SMS sender for those SMS sent from Upvise, so the name can be more meaningful to the person receiving it.

  • PO Manual Data sync has been deprecated:
    Deprecated "PO Number Sync" option in manual data sync as this was being misused, resulting in the PO numbers being "reset" in Upvise. Clients needing Upvise PO number sequenced should engage support or your dedicated consultant.

  • Equipment Repair Jobs:
    These can now be created in Upvise where a service log in Workbench will generate against the plant item.
    Create an Equipment repair job in Upvise against the equipment item.

SAP B1

  • Support for exporting Stock Qty batch types has been added.

Xero

  • GL Accounts import:
    An enhancement has been done on the import of GL accounts from Xero, to exclude GL accounts in Xero that do not have a GL Code. These are commonly used in Xero for Credit Cards and do not require a GL Code to be set. However, Workbench does require a GL Code for GL Accounts, and the import was failing due to those accounts.

  • Improved error messages:
    When errors occur exporting batches to Xero, Xero returns typically an error and Codes or IDs, which correspond to Employee Names, Earning rates, etc. We have improved the displaying of these errors translating the Xero IDs returned in the Error messages to something easy to understand by the user exporting. This should assist in troubleshooting and understanding what is causing the error.

  • No labels